Jon Cherry: Balancing Gold Economics, National Defense, and Regulatory Certainty

Nov 21, 2025
Jon Cherry, CEO of Perpetua Resources, leads the charge on the Stibnite Gold Project, crucial for U.S. antimony supply. He delves into the project's significance for national defense, highlighting its unique antimony reserve. Cherry discusses a monumental $255 million financing deal, the challenges of domestic processing, and how gold economics drive the initiative. He shares insights on community engagement, continuous restoration efforts, and the broader outlook for critical minerals, emphasizing a balanced approach between engineering, policy, and community relations.

Three Paths To Domestic Processing

  • Potential processors fall into three buckets: U.S. legacy processors, foreign processors willing to relocate or invest, and allied-country expanders.
  • Strong industry and government interest increases the likelihood U.S. capacity will be built before Stibnite's production ramp.

Use Equity To Fund Early Works

  • Raise staged equity to execute early works while negotiating large project financing.
  • Use early equity to fund campsite, power, roads, long-lead orders and detailed engineering to preserve schedule.

Major Strategic Investors Joined

  • Agnico Eagle invested $180M to take a strategic equity stake and join an advisory committee for construction and exploration.
  • JPMorgan invested $75M as the inaugural recipient of its Strategic Resilience Initiative focused on critical minerals.
